What Is PCIT (Parent-Child Interaction Therapy)?

PCIT is a structured, research-backed therapy designed for young children (typically ages 2–7) and their caregivers. Unlike traditional talk therapy, PCIT focuses on real-time coaching to help parents strengthen their relationship with their child while improving behavior.
Instead of only working on the child, PCIT works with the parent and child together — because parents are the most powerful agents of change in a child’s life.
Who Can Benefit from PCIT?

PCIT is especially helpful for families experiencing:
Frequent tantrums or meltdowns
Defiance or refusal to follow directions
Aggressive or disruptive behaviors
Emotional outbursts or difficulty self-regulating
Struggles after major life changes (divorce, trauma, transitions)
Parent-child relationship strain

What Happens During PCIT Sessions?

PCIT is broken into two main phases:
1. Relationship-Building Phase
Parents learn skills to:
Increase positive attention
Strengthen emotional connection
Help children feel safe, seen, and understood
This phase lays the foundation for trust and emotional regulation.
2. Behavior-Coaching Phase
Parents are coached on:
Giving clear, effective directions
Setting consistent boundaries
Using calm, predictable discipline strategies
Therapists provide live feedback and guidance, helping parents practice skills in the moment — not just talk about them.
How PCIT Is Different from Traditional Therapy
✔ Therapy happens with your child present✔ Parents receive hands-on coaching, not just advice✔ Skills are practiced in real time✔ Progress is measurable and goal-oriented✔ Results often appear faster than talk therapy alone
PCIT empowers parents with tools they can use every day at home, long after therapy ends.
